Otzma Yehudit Party Names Tal Gottlieb Second on Election List
National Security Minister Itamar Ben Gvir announced on Tuesday that Tal Gottlieb will be placed second on the Otzma Yehudit party's list for the upcoming Knesset elections. This decision positions Gottlieb, a Member of Knesset, as a prominent figure within the party's electoral slate.
Ben Gvir, who leads Otzma Yehudit, made the announcement, signaling a significant move in the party's preparations for the elections. The second position on the list is typically considered a highly influential spot, suggesting Gottlieb is slated for a key role should the party gain representation in the Knesset.
While the exact date of the elections has not been specified, the parties are actively formulating their electoral strategies and lists. Gottlieb's placement indicates Ben Gvir's confidence in her political standing and her importance to the party's electoral success. Otzma Yehudit is a right-wing party known for its nationalist and religious platform.
